A television set today is considered as much a part of any household as refrigerate or a cupboard. It has become one of the most widespread forms of entertainment. Not only does it provide entertainment, but also allows us to access a great variety of information and happenings around the world.There are several channels that provide movies,music,fashion,sports or news.
This has given rise to a tendency for Channel surfing especially teenagers. They cannot concentrate on anyone program.There are channels that beam programs tewnty-four hours a day. Whereas this may be a boon for people who do not have much time to do any way, it becomes a source of distraction for children for whom priority should be their studies. If parents do not monitor the programs and time spent by children in front of TV.,there is a bound to be a negative effect on their overall development. The numerous television channels have truly brought the world into homes. The entire world watched Obama taking his presidential oath. Now we can watch the election activities from every corner of the country. While it is good to be aware of the happening around the world.,watching programs and portraying violence can have a negative impact on the sensitive and delicate minds of children's. Elderly people who cannot leave the hose often.,like to sit before TV and watch old movies and programs. For the religious mided there are quite a few channels devoted to regions. Cricket and football fans no longer need to sweat it out in the stadium in order to watch their favourite teams play on the TV.However, in front of the TV you miss the thrill and excitement that can be experienced in the stadium. Children can learn about people and cultures of different countries, they can watch animals in their natural habitat through channels like Discovery and National Geographic. But there is always the fear that th child would miss out on all the fun and adventure that can be had with a healthy open air outing.
Just as the television provides the cheapest entertainment today, it has also brought forth a lot of talent through competitions and reality shows. Whereas it is known to have created a rift amongst family members by way of arguments over which channel to watch, there are numerous times when the family enjoys a program sitting together.
